Celluloid Junkie is proud to announce that nominations are now officially open for the fourth edition of our Top Women in Global Distribution list — celebrating 50 exceptional women shaping the future of film distribution worldwide.

The 2025 list will be published on December 16th, following the success of our ninth annual Top Women in Global Cinema list in June. And similarly to the cinema exhibition list, this year sees an important change to the nominations process. To make the selection procedure as fair and straightforward as possible we’re introducing some simple criteria, which, ultimately, help us to produce the most deserving list possible. We ask that nominees meet the following criteria:

  • Candidate should have been working in film distribution for a minimum of two years.
  • Candidate should hold at least a management level position. 
  • Candidate should be able to demonstrate extracurricular activities / achievements / recognition / initiatives. These don’t necessarily have to be directly related to the distribution industry but can be outlined via the submission form.

Specifically, we’re looking for how nominees have made a positive difference to their company beyond their daily work, which in turn, has contributed to the broader distribution and / or film industries. Along with any career highlights and background information, please be sure to update any nomination with relevant accomplishments from the last 12-18 months.
